Purification and partial characterization of Cob(I)alamin adenosyltransferase from Pseudomonas denitrificans

L Debussche et al. J Bacteriol. 1991 Oct.

Abstract

Cob(I)alamin adenosyltransferase (EC 2.5.1.17) was purified to homogeneity from extracts of a Pseudomonas denitrificans recombinant strain and sequenced at its N terminus. It is a homodimer (each unit with an Mr of 28,000) encoded by cobO. The enzyme adenosylated all of the corrinoids isolated from this microorganism but did not adenosylate cobyrinic acid.
